Abstract

A power plant operating on steam for producing electric power including a plurality of integrated power plant unit modules each having a steam turbine responsive to the steam and producing heat depleted steam, a steam condenser associated with the steam turbine operating at a pressure no less than atmospheric pressure for collecting non-condensable gases and condensing the heat depleted steam and vaporizing organic fluid applied to the condenser, a closed organic Rankine cycle turbine operating on the organic fluid and a single electric generator driven by the steam turbine and the organic Rankine cycle turbine for producing electric power, and also including means for supplying in parallel the steam to each steam turbine in each of the modules. A method for producing electric power using steam is also described.
